Sunpower Corporation Systems EditDelete Industrial Classification 23821. Electrical ContractorsBusiness Type CORPOwner Name Sunpower Corporation SystemsStreet Address 1414 Harbour S WayCity RichmondState CAZip Code 94804-3694Phone Number 510 540-055023531